Show Me the Release Notes!

Gyrus

An ongoing history of software releases provided by an LMS vendor proves that they invest resources into developing the product by adding new features and fixing problems. Creating a Culture of Continuous Learning

Gyrus

The best way to ready ourselves for this shifting environment is Continuous Learning. Continuous learning is an established persistent learning process, designed for bolstering the knowledge and skills of your workforce over time, and presents itself in many forms.
